Thomson is 0-10 against Burke County since April of 2018 but things could change on Tuesday. Thomson will square off against Burke County at 5:30 p.m. Both squads will be entering this one on the heels of a big victory.
Thomson's pitching crew heads into the contest hoping to repeat the dominance they displayed on Friday. They put the hurt on Butler with a sharp 18-0 win. The victory was nothing new for Thomson as they're now sitting on three straight.

Tre Lazenby was incredible, going 3-for-4 with one home run, four runs, and five RBI. He has been hot recently, having posted three or more RBI the last three times he's played. Wyatt Lowe also deserves some recognition as he snagged his first stolen base of the season.
Lazenby wasn't the only one working in the hit department: Thomson kept the outfield on their toes and finished the game with 14 hits.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now got at least 14 hits in three consecutive matches.
Meanwhile, Burke County entered their tilt with Glenn Hills on Friday with two consecutive wins, and they'll enter their next game with three. They blew past the Spartans 15-0. That's two games straight that the Bears have won by exactly 15 runs.
Nate Cadle and Sam Kyzer did most of the damage at the plate: Cadle scored two runs and stole a base while going 1-for-1, while Kyzer scored two runs while going 1-for-2. Kyzer is becoming a predictor of Burke County's success: when he posts at least two runs the team is undefeated (and 6-9 when he doesn't). Christian Smith was another key player, scoring a run while going 1-for-1.
The win got Burke County back to even at 9-9. As for Thomson, their record now sits at 13-4.
Burke County's pitching crew has a crucial task ahead of them: Thomson hasn't had any issues making contact this season, having earned a batting average of .380. It's a different story for Burke County, though, as they've only averaged .250. Will they be able to contain Thomson's hitters?
